Beet Yellows: Virus

Symptoms

  • This disease is transmitted mainly through aphids.
  • The important symptoms of the disease include yellow spots on the young leaves in the initial stages of infection.
  • As the disease progresses, the leaves exhibit irregular yellow patches alternating with normal green colour of the leaves.
  • The older leaves of infected plants become chlorotic, noticeably thickened, leathery and brittle. The foliage becomes abnormally red or yellow and often dies.

Management

  • Control measures include removal of infected plants and weeds from the field.
  • The disease incidence can be minimized by controlling the population of aphids by spraying oxydemeton Methyl 25 EC (2ml/litre of water)
